An ageing nun is tracked to ground by her sister; a garrulous beautician must lay out the corpse of a loved one.
These are eloquent tales of exile and displacement, of characters always in search of a way back home or of a way to leave it. Mischievous, assured and versatile, Colum McCann's collection of short stories marks him out as one of our best contemporary writers.
